Across Rwanda, the spirit of Adventism thrives. The Seventh Day Adventist Church stands as a testament to a century of faith and growth. More than 40,000 Adventists gathered at Kigali’s Amahoro National Stadium in 2019. They celebrated 100 years of their church in Rwanda. The Seventh Day Adventist Church has deep roots here. In 1919, missionaries first brought the Adventist message to this land. Their legacy is honored within the walls of the Seventh Day Adventist Church. These early missionaries learned the local language and culture. They shared the gospel through education and healthcare. Today, the Seventh Day Adventist Church boasts a significant presence in Rwanda. In Kigali alone, there are multiple Seventh Day Adventist churches serving the community. Across the country, there are over 1,900 churches. Nearly 1.2 million members contribute to the vibrant tapestry of Rwandan life. The Seventh Day Adventist Church continues to grow. From its humble beginnings, it has blossomed into a powerful force for good in Rwanda. It partners with the government in education, health, and development initiatives.
